    A reconnaissance Marine with the 31st Marine Expeditionary Unit’s Force Reconnaissance Platoon rigs a parachute before military free fall operations at Anderson Air Force Base, Guam, June 16, 2018. FRP trains for free fall operations using a high altitude low opening jump in order to hone insertion capabilities. The 31st MEU, the Marine Corps’ only continuously forward-deployed MEU, provides a flexible force ready to perform a wide-range of military operations.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Lance Cpl. Alexis B. Betances/Released)
